Ventilation is one of the most important COVID-19 prevention strategies for schools and child care settings. Good ventilation can reduce the number of virus particles in the air, which reduces the likelihood of spreading COVID-19 and other respiratory illnesses. They voted to close the school in May 2023.Deciding to close a school is a local decision, and one that USBE will not provide the directive on, especially if it is a public health concern. In the case of COVID-19, the decision to close a school would come from the local public health officials. USBE will be publishing considerations on potential school closure thresholds. In March 2020, nurseries, schools, and colleges in the United Kingdom were shut down in response to the COVID-19 pandemic. By 20 March, all schools in the UK had closed for all in-person teaching, except for children of key workers and children considered vulnerable.
